Output 8909197ea60473feab3182707acb341dee11376c813b12f54172559e32580935: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3759a0ba860335a1a549327a42e3d3d35f536 OP_EQUAL
address
3BMEXYHzSW7PMHhy2Zvrdcnz3Gzi3fdyNp
transaction
8909197ea60473feab3182707acb341dee11376c813b12f54172559e32580935
confirmations
356356
spent
true